a drug screen. COTAt FT (64 Hours) Position Summary: At the
direction of a Registered Occupational Therapist, performs patient
treatments as indicated by the treatment plan. Documents treatments
given, including frequent and objective measurements. Works with
childrenl through geriatric patients with clinical competency.
Completes established competencies for the position within
designated introductory period. Performs selected tests and
measurements as directed by therapist; maintains documentation on
all treatments; assures appropriate equipment performance prior to
each use. Position requires every other weekend and every other
holiday commitment. Qualifications: EDUCATION Required: Associate
degree in occupational therapy assistant, Active U.S. military
service members, or veterans with any military service, training,
or education verified and credited by an accredited OTA program is
acceptable EXPERIENCE Preferred: 1 year experience CERTIFICATIONS
Required: Certified Occupational Therapy Assistant by AOTA.
